A chess dispute is an 1903 british short blackandwhite silent comedy film, directed by robert w.

Paul was born in liverpool road, in presentday inner london, and began his technical career learning instrumentmaking skills at the elliott brothers, a firm of london instrument makers founded in 1804, followed by the bell telephone company in antwerp.
